“Senjutsu,” Iron Maiden’s 17th studio album, dropped today, and drummer Nicko McBrain returns to talk about the writing and recording of what’s sure to become another Maiden classic. He talks about recording just before the pandemic shutdown, sitting on the album during the pandemic, and the decision to release it now. In addition, he speaks to Maiden’s tour plans, the songs he’s most looking forward to playing, his favorites from the new album, and the band’s chemistry and working relationship. He also shares some great trainwreck stories from past tours, the tale behind how he got his name, plans for his side project tribute bands, and his thoughts on the recent loss of the late, great Rolling Stones drummer Charlie Watts.
